关于java入门与java开发环境配置详细教程

关于Java入门

本教程将指导您如何入门Java编程。Java是一门跨平台的编程语言,在Web开发、桌面开发以及移动开发领域都有广泛应用。本教程包括Java基础语法、常用类库以及一些基本的编程思想,帮助您在开始Java编程之前对它有一个初步了解。

Java入门基础

Java入门基础包括以下内容:

  1. Java基础语法
  2. 类、对象和方法
  3. 控制语句和循环结构
  4. 面向对象编程基本思想
  5. 异常处理机制
  6. Java集合框架

在掌握以上基础知识之后,您可以开始自己写简单的Java程序。

Java开发环境配置

Java开发环境配置包括以下内容:

  1. 安装JDK(Java Development Kit)
  2. 配置Java环境变量
  3. 安装Eclipse等开发工具
  4. 配置开发工具

以下是安装JDK的简单教程(示例为Windows平台):

  1. 打开Oracle官网: https://www.oracle.com/technetwork/java/javase/downloads/index.html
  2. 下载Java Development Kit
  3. 安装JDK

安装完成后,需要进行Java环境变量配置:

  1. 在控制面板中找到“系统和安全”,点击“系统”,然后点击“高级系统设置”
  2. 点击“环境变量”,找到“系统变量”下的“Path”,点击“编辑”按钮
  3. 在编辑环境变量对话框中点击“新建”,添加JDK的bin目录,例如C:\Program Files\Java\jdk1.8.0_211\bin
  4. 环境变量配置完成

接下来需要安装开发工具,这里以Eclipse为例:

  1. 打开Eclipse官网:https://www.eclipse.org/downloads/
  2. 下载Eclipse IDE for Java Developers
  3. 安装Eclipse

最后我们需要进行一些开发工具的配置:

  1. 设置JDK路径,进入Eclipse,点击“Window”-“Preferences”
  2. 找到“Java”-“Installed JREs”,点击添加按钮
  3. 选择标准VM,点击下一步,在JRE的路径中选择安装的JDK路径
  4. 配置完成

示例说明

假设现在我们需要创建一个Java程序,用于计算两数之和。首先我们需要创建一个Java类。

public class Calculation {
    public static void main(String[] args) {
        int a = 3;
        int b = 5;
        int res = Calculation.add(a, b);
        System.out.println("结果为:" + res);
    }

    public static int add(int a, int b) {
        return a+b;
    }
}

在编写好上述代码后,我们需要进行编译并执行。在控制台上输出“结果为:8”。

$ javac Calculation.java
$ java Calculation

在这个示例中,我们创建了一个名为“Calculation”的Java类,其中包含一个add方法,用于计算两数之和。利用main方法,我们可以在控制台上输出结果。

另外一个示例是,我们需要创建一个学生类,其中包含姓名、年龄和学号等属性。

public class Student {
    private String name;
    private int age;
    private String id;

    public Student(String name, int age, String id) {
        this.name = name;
        this.age = age;
        this.id = id;
    }

    public String getName() {
        return name;
    }

    public int getAge() {
        return age;
    }

    public String getId() {
        return id;
    }
}

在这个示例中,我们创建了一个名为“Student”的Java类,其中包含三个私有属性,即姓名、年龄和学号。使用构造方法可以对属性进行初始化,使用get方法获取属性值。

以上就是Java入门和Java开发环境配置的详细攻略。希望对您有所帮助。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:关于java入门与java开发环境配置详细教程 - Python技术站

(0)
上一篇 2023年6月27日
下一篇 2023年6月27日

相关文章

  • 【c#基础概念】unicode编码详解

    【C#基础概念】Unicode编码详解 Unicode是一种字符编码标准,它为每个字符分配了一个唯一的数字,以便在计算机中进行存储和处理。本攻略将介绍Unicode编码的基本概念、编码方式、转换方法以及在C#中的应用。 Unicode编码基本概念 Unicode编码是一种字符编码标准,它为每个字符分配了一个唯一的数字,以便在计算机中进行存储和处理。Unico…

    other 2023年5月7日
    00
  • .NET中获取程序根目录的常用方法介绍

    获取程序根目录在.NET中是一项常见的需求,因为程序可能需要读取配置文件、提供给用户下载的文件等。下面我们将介绍.NET中获取程序根目录的3种常用方法。 1. 使用AppDomain.CurrentDomain.BaseDirectory string baseDirectory = AppDomain.CurrentDomain.BaseDirectory…

    other 2023年6月27日
    00
  • windows系统怎么把虚拟内存从C盘移到D盘?

    将虚拟内存从C盘移到D盘的攻略 以下是将虚拟内存从C盘移到D盘的详细步骤: 打开“控制面板”:点击Windows开始菜单,然后在搜索栏中输入“控制面板”,并选择打开。 进入“系统和安全”:在控制面板中,找到“系统和安全”选项,然后点击进入。 打开“系统”:在“系统和安全”页面中,找到“系统”选项,然后点击进入。 进入“高级系统设置”:在“系统”页面中,找到右…

    other 2023年8月1日
    00
  • linux一些基本命令以及初级网络配置方法

    Linux基本命令 目录和文件命令 cd:进入到指定目录,用法:cd 目录路径 ls:列出当前目录下的所有文件和目录,用法:ls mkdir:创建一个新目录,用法:mkdir 目录名 touch:创建一个新文件,用法:touch 文件名 rm:删除一个文件或目录,用法:rm 文件名 或 rm -r 目录 文件编辑命令 vi:用于编辑文本文件,常用的命令有: …

    other 2023年6月26日
    00
  • Hadoop 文件系统命令行基础详解

    Hadoop 文件系统命令行基础详解 在进行hadoop文件系统管理时,可以使用Hadoop文件系统(HDFS)命令行接口来完成各种任务。本攻略将详细介绍HDFS命令行的基本语法和常用命令。 HDFS命令行模式 使用以下命令进入HDFS命令行模式: hadoop fs 在命令模式下,用户可以执行各种文件系统操作。 基本的HDFS命令 查看HDFS文件系统状态…

    other 2023年6月27日
    00
  • Python判断两个对象相等的原理

    Python判断两个对象相等的原理主要有两种:值相等(Value equality)和引用相等(Reference equality)。值相等指的是两个对象的值相同,而引用相等指的是两个对象指向同一个内存地址。 对于字符串、数字和元组等不可变类型,Python会默认使用值相等来判断两个对象是否相等。例如下面的示例代码: a = "hello&quo…

    other 2023年6月27日
    00
  • ios延时执行的四种方法

    以下是详细讲解“iOS延时执行的四种方法的完整攻略”的标准Markdown格式文本,包含两个示例说明: iOS延时执行的四种方法的完整攻略 在iOS开发中,有时需要延时执行某些代码,例如延时加载数据、延时执行动画等。本攻将介绍iOS延时执行的四种方法。 方法一:使用GCD的dispatch_after函数 使用GCD的dispatch_after函数可以实现…

    other 2023年5月10日
    00
  • Android自定义PopupWindow小案例

    我们开始讲解如何实现一个Android自定义PopupWindow小案例。 前置知识 Android基础知识,包括控件、事件等等 Android Studio开发环境的使用 实现思路 我们要实现的自定义PopupWindow,不同于系统提供的PopupWindow,我们要自定义PopupWindow的背景、动画、内容、位置等,因此需要重写PopupWindo…

    other 2023年6月25日
    00
合作推广
合作推广
分享本页
返回顶部